mirror of
				https://github.com/kevinveenbirkenbach/infinito.git
				synced 2025-10-31 09:19:08 +00:00 
			
		
		
		
	Optimized namespaces
This commit is contained in:
		| @@ -12,6 +12,7 @@ use App\Entity\Source\SourceInterface; | ||||
| use App\Creator\Factory\Template\Source\SourceTemplateFormFactory; | ||||
| use App\Creator\Factory\Form\Source\SourceFormFactory; | ||||
| use Symfony\Component\HttpFoundation\RedirectResponse; | ||||
| use App\Entity\Source\AbstractSource; | ||||
|  | ||||
| /** | ||||
|  * @todo IMPLEMENT SECURITY! | ||||
| @@ -26,8 +27,8 @@ class SourceController extends FOSRestController | ||||
|     public function show(Request $request, int $id): Response | ||||
|     { | ||||
|         $source = $this->loadSource($request, $id); | ||||
|         $assembler = $this->get(SourceDTOAssember::class); | ||||
|         $dto = $assembler->build($source, $this->getUser()); | ||||
|         #$assembler = $this->get(SourceDTOAssember::class); | ||||
|         #$dto = $assembler->build($source, $this->getUser()); | ||||
|         $view = $this->view($source, 200) | ||||
|             ->setTemplate((new SourceTemplateFactory($source, $request))->getTemplatePath()) | ||||
|             ->setTemplateVar('source'); | ||||
|   | ||||
| @@ -7,7 +7,7 @@ use App\Entity\Source\SourceInterface; | ||||
| /** | ||||
|  * @author kevinfrantz | ||||
|  */ | ||||
| class AbstractSourceFactory | ||||
| abstract class AbstractSourceFactory | ||||
| { | ||||
|     /** | ||||
|      * @var SourceInterface | ||||
|   | ||||
| @@ -4,7 +4,7 @@ namespace App\Creator\Factory\Template\Source; | ||||
|  | ||||
| use App\Entity\Source\SourceInterface; | ||||
| use Symfony\Component\HttpFoundation\Request; | ||||
| use Creator\Factory\AbstractSourceFactory; | ||||
| use App\Creator\Factory\AbstractSourceFactory; | ||||
|  | ||||
| /** | ||||
|  * @author kevinfrantz | ||||
|   | ||||
| @@ -26,7 +26,7 @@ class UserSource extends AbstractSource implements UserSourceInterface | ||||
|     protected $user; | ||||
|  | ||||
|     /** | ||||
|      * @Assert\Type(type="App\Entity\NameSource") | ||||
|      * @Assert\Type(type="App\Entity\Source\NameSource") | ||||
|      * @Assert\Valid() | ||||
|      * @ORM\OneToOne(targetEntity="NameSource",cascade={"persist", "remove"}) | ||||
|      * @ORM\JoinColumn(name="name_id", referencedColumnName="id") | ||||
|   | ||||
| @@ -6,7 +6,7 @@ use Symfony\Component\Form\AbstractType; | ||||
| use Symfony\Component\Form\FormBuilderInterface; | ||||
| use Symfony\Component\OptionsResolver\OptionsResolver; | ||||
| use Symfony\Component\Form\Extension\Core\Type\TextType; | ||||
| use App\Entity\NameSource; | ||||
| use App\Entity\Source\NameSource; | ||||
|  | ||||
| class NameSourceType extends AbstractType | ||||
| { | ||||
|   | ||||
		Reference in New Issue
	
	Block a user